This course will run online over 3 nights per week for 4 semesters with classes taking place in the evenings between 6 pm and 10 pm as follows: Tuesday 6pm-10pm, Wednesday 6.30pm to 8.30pm Thursday 6.30pm to 8.30pm (subject to change) Course taught using an online learning approach, this course provides a balanced learning experience that is both a structured and flexible learner experience for students which makes it ideal for students in active employment.
Programme summary
The aim of this programme is to provide students with the knowledge, skills and competencies to design and develop digital assets for computer animation production and to evaluate and manage these assets in a production pipeline.
Entry requirements
A minimum Second-Class Honours (2.2) in Level 8 Computing from a recognised third level institution, or equivalent qualification in a cognate discipline OR A minimum Second-Class Honours (2.2) Higher Diploma in Science in Computing (or similar) Level 8 award. Technology Requirements: Applicants must have at least this level of spec (see below) to be able to complete these courses. Operating System: Windows 10 64 bit. CPU/ Processor: Quad-core Intel or AMD 2.5 GHz or faster. 64-bit Intel or AMD with SSE4.2 instruction set. Memory: 8 GB Ram (Min) 16 GB or more recommended Graphics/Video Card: Direct X 11 or 12 Compatible Graphics Card Direct X 11/12: Latest drivers Vulkan:AMD (21.11.3+) and NVIDIA ( 496.76+)
